Python 3 - Método String split ()

Descrição

o split() O método retorna uma lista de todas as palavras na string, usando str como separador (divisões em todos os espaços em branco se não forem especificados), opcionalmente limitando o número de divisões a num.

Sintaxe

A seguir está a sintaxe para split() método -

str.split(str="", num = string.count(str)).

Parâmetros

  • str - Este é qualquer delimitador, por padrão é o espaço.

  • num - este é o número de linhas a serem feitas

Valor de retorno

Este método retorna uma lista de linhas.

Exemplo

O exemplo a seguir mostra o uso do método split ().

#!/usr/bin/python3

str = "this is string example....wow!!!"
print (str.split( ))
print (str.split('i',1))
print (str.split('w'))

Resultado

Quando executamos o programa acima, ele produz o seguinte resultado -

['this', 'is', 'string', 'example....wow!!!']
['th', 's is string example....wow!!!']
['this is string example....', 'o', '!!!']